Subject: [PATCH v8 02/11] net: add ndo to setup/query xdp prog in adapter rx
Date: Tue, 12 Jul 2016 00:51:25 -0700 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<1468309894-26258-3-git-send-email-bblanco@plumgrid.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<1468309894-26258-1-git-send-email-bblanco@plumgrid.com>
Add one new netdev op for drivers implementing the BPF_PROG_TYPE_XDP
filter. The single op is used for both setup/query of the xdp program,
modelled after ndo_setup_tc.

+/* These structures hold the attributes of xdp state that are being passed
+ * to the netdevice through the xdp op.
+ */
+enum xdp_netdev_command {
+ /* Set or clear a bpf program used in the earliest stages of packet
+ * rx. The prog will have been loaded as BPF_PROG_TYPE_XDP. The callee
+ * is responsible for calling bpf_prog_put on any old progs that are
+ * stored. In case of error, the callee need not release the new prog
+ * reference, but on success it takes ownership and must bpf_prog_put
+ * when it is no longer used.
+ */
+ XDP_SETUP_PROG,
+ /* Check if a bpf program is set on the device. The callee should
+ * return true if a program is currently attached and running.
+ */
+ XDP_QUERY_PROG,
+};
+
+struct netdev_xdp {
+ enum xdp_netdev_command command;
+ union {
+ /* XDP_SETUP_PROG */
+ struct bpf_prog *prog;
+ /* XDP_QUERY_PROG */
+ bool prog_attached;
+ };
+};

/**
+ * dev_change_xdp_fd - set or clear a bpf program for a device rx path
+ * @dev: device
+ * @fd: new program fd or negative value to clear
+ *
+ * Set or clear a bpf program for a device
+ */
+int dev_change_xdp_fd(struct net_device *dev, int fd)
+{
+ const struct net_device_ops *ops = dev->netdev_ops;
+ struct bpf_prog *prog = NULL;
+ struct netdev_xdp xdp = {};
+ int err;
+
+ if (!ops->ndo_xdp)
+ return -EOPNOTSUPP;
+ if (fd >= 0) {
+ prog = bpf_prog_get_type(fd, BPF_PROG_TYPE_XDP);
+ if (IS_ERR(prog))
+ return PTR_ERR(prog);
+ }
+
+ xdp.command = XDP_SETUP_PROG;
+ xdp.prog = prog;
+ err = ops->ndo_xdp(dev, &xdp);
+ if (err < 0 && prog)
+ bpf_prog_put(prog);
+
+ return err;
+}
+EXPORT_SYMBOL(dev_change_xdp_fd);
